Sustainable Appliances
The average US household spends nearly $2,000 per year on energy bills, according to the Energy Department. With energy costs continuing to rise, now is the perfect time to invest in energy-efficient appliances for your kitchen. Look for appliances with the ENERGY STAR® label—it means they have been tested and certified by the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) as being energy efficient. Additionally, you may qualify for local government rebates or tax credits if you purchase certain ENERGY STAR appliances.

Recycled Countertops
Instead of opting for traditional countertop materials like granite or marble that require mining and quarrying, consider recycled countertops instead! You can find recycled glass or even recycled paper countertops that are just as beautiful as their natural counterparts but are significantly better for the environment. Plus, many companies offer a lifetime warranty on these materials so you can rest assured that your investment will last.

LED Lighting
LED lighting has become increasingly popular over the last few years due to its low energy consumption and long lifespan compared to traditional incandescent bulbs. LED lights are available in a wide variety of shapes, sizes, and colors making them perfect for accentuating any room of the house without breaking the bank or using too much electricity in the process. LED lights are also much safer than traditional incandescent bulbs as they don’t get hot like regular bulbs do which means less risk of fire hazard or injury from contact with hot surfaces.

Sustainable Materials
Sustainable materials such as bamboo, cork, and recycled wood are becoming increasingly popular when it comes to creating an eco-friendly kitchen. These materials are not only environmentally friendly but they also look great in any space! Bamboo, for example, is a great choice for floors because it’s durable and water-resistant. Plus, it has a beautiful natural grain that can really tie together any room. Cork flooring is another good option because it’s easy to clean and maintain while still looking stylish. And if you want something with a bit more color and texture, then recycled wood may be the way to go!
